How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ralston?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ralston Studio Apartments | $1,109 | $983 | $1,300 |
| Ralston 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,204 | $515 | $3,199 |
| Ralston 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,700 | $669 | $3,699 |
| Ralston 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,727 | $555 | $3,149 |
| Ralston 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,841 | $455 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Ralston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Ralston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Ralston is $1,727.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Ralston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Ralston is a 1,750 square feet unit starting from $1,550 at Waters Edge Duplexes.
What is the average size for Ralston 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Ralston is currently 1,106 sq ft.
